Position Summary

 

The Plant Resilience Institute (PRI) at Michigan State University is seeking a highly motivated and interdisciplinary postdoctoral researcher with strong computational and data science skills to join a project focused on identifying causal environmental drivers of crop resilience and yield. The project integrates field-based environmental monitoring, quantitative trait data, and controlled environmental simulations to uncover key environmental variables influencing plant performance across diverse agricultural conditions.

This position will focus on the computational aspects of the project, including data integration, association analyses (EWAS), and development of predictive models using large, multi-dimensional datasets. The postdoc will work closely with PRI researchers and external partners to translate complex environmental and phenotypic data into actionable insights for crop improvement and climate adaptation strategies.

This is an exciting opportunity to contribute to a pioneering approach in plant science that connects quantitative genetics, environmental sensing, and agricultural data science at scale.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Integrate and analyze large-scale environmental and biological datasets collected from multi-site field trials and controlled-environment experiments
  • Perform association analyses (e.g., EWAS) to identify environmental variables significantly correlated with plant traits such as yield and stress resilience
  • Collaborate with sensor teams, plant scientists, and data engineers to develop robust, reproducible data workflows
  • Contribute to the development of computational tools and pipelines for spatial, temporal, and multi-omic data
  • Support the synthesis of pilot findings and contribute to future research directions and proposals
